WWE: Rey Mysterio - The Life of a Masked Man is a revealing dive into the career of one of wrestling's most distinctive figures. It’s not just a collection of matches; it’s Rey sharing the highs and lows of his journey, with a tone that feels both personal and reflective. The pacing ebbs and flows, allowing his stories to breathe—like the way he navigates through his rivalries and triumphs. The practical effects of his grappling artistry and the visceral nature of his performances come alive as he discusses his time across ECW, WCW, and WWE. There’s a genuine warmth in his retrospective, making it feel like you’re sitting down with an old friend who’s willing to unveil the man behind the mask.
This documentary saw limited releases on DVD and Blu-ray, making it a bit of a gem for collectors. As wrestling documentaries go, it captures a unique perspective that fans crave, especially those who appreciate the evolution of lucha libre in mainstream wrestling. Scarcity might not be extreme, but the interest in Rey Mysterio memorabilia keeps it on the radar for enthusiasts looking for comprehensive insights into his career.
